I didn't get much done for the game last weekend, but I did create this adorable 8bit-ish Egee!

I don't actually know what qualifies as "8bit". Like, the sprite is 32x32 but it uses the NES color palette so...? Either way, it's a NES-inspired Egee sprite!

I started out in Aseprite trying to re-create Scrooge McDuck for DuckTales on NES. I couldn't figure out how to include his top hat so I removed it and replaced it with some hair floof.


My plan was to re-create all of the animations for Mr McDuck but after I finished the first animation frame I wondered, why not spend this effort on an Egee sprite instead?

The Egee sprite looks a little derpy but I've literally never done anything like this before so I'm not sure how to fix it. 😂 And the NES color palette doesn't have a color that matches Egee's "red" fur so NES Egee is a really Red Husky.


For the first game, I'm definitely going to make all of the sprites myself. If nothing else, it will be good practice for me to decide whether I like it or hate it.

Making Pixel Egee was actually really fun but I don't know if I have that artistic "gift" that some artists have. Hopefully my style is passable to make 2D game assets!
